About ROB

Visionary Developer | Tribal Connector | Strategic Catalyst

Rob Day, of Navajo and Comanche heritage, is a visionary developer based in the southwest. Known for his rare ability to connect tribal communities, investors, and innovators, Rob specializes in strategic evaluation, ideation, and project mobilization.

Focused, driven, and rooted in cultural accountability, he delivers projects that matter at scale.
